> The guests should log themselves off. Do you have vmpoff=LOGOFF added to
> /etc/zipl.conf?

Not required (and not desired) when using CP SIGNAL SHUTDOWN.  Just let
Linux and CP do their thing.  CP is waiting for Linux to load a special
"shutdown complete" PSW.
